1//! What one read of the deployed contracts could — and could not — say about
2//! declared task queues.
3//!
4//! A catalog can retain entries whose stored identity carries no decodable
5//! contract at all: every package deployed before the `.v4` contract identity
6//! reads that way. The handshake migration creates exactly that mixture —
7//! old packages retained beside newly deployed `.v4` ones — so a bare set of
8//! found queues is not an honest answer. Such a set reads as authoritative
9//! while silently omitting whatever the undecodable entries declare, and a
10//! caller that treats its absences as facts refuses dispatches nobody
11//! contradicted.
12//!
13//! This type keeps both halves of the answer together, so a reader can tell
14//! "no deployed contract declares this queue" apart from "this read could not
15//! have seen it".
16
17use std::collections::BTreeSet;
18
19use aion_package::ContractIdentityError;
20
21use super::load::LoadedWorkflow;
22
23/// The queues one catalog read positively found, with the stored identities
24/// that same read could not decode.
25///
26/// A positive find is a fact regardless of what the read missed. An ABSENCE is
27/// only a fact when [`Self::covers_every_entry`] holds.
28#[derive(Clone, Debug, Default, Eq, PartialEq)]
29pub struct DeclaredQueues {
30    declared: BTreeSet<String>,
31    undecodable_identities: Vec<String>,
32}
33
34impl DeclaredQueues {
35    /// Records one read: the queues found, and the stored identities that could
36    /// not be decoded — empty exactly when the read covered every entry.
37    #[must_use]
38    pub fn new(declared: BTreeSet<String>, undecodable_identities: Vec<String>) -> Self {
39        Self {
40            declared,
41            undecodable_identities,
42        }
43    }
44
45    /// Whether a decoded contract declares `task_queue`.
46    #[must_use]
47    pub fn declares(&self, task_queue: &str) -> bool {
48        self.declared.contains(task_queue)
49    }
50
51    /// Whether every retained entry decoded — the only condition under which
52    /// this read's absences carry information.
53    #[must_use]
54    pub fn covers_every_entry(&self) -> bool {
55        self.undecodable_identities.is_empty()
56    }
57
58    /// The stored identities this read could not decode, in catalog order.
59    #[must_use]
60    pub fn undecodable_identities(&self) -> &[String] {
61        &self.undecodable_identities
62    }
63
64    /// Whether the read found no queue declaration at all. Such a catalog
65    /// contradicts nothing, whether or not the read was complete.
66    #[must_use]
67    pub fn found_no_declaration(&self) -> bool {
68        self.declared.is_empty()
69    }
70
71    /// Every queue this read found.
72    #[must_use]
73    pub fn declared(&self) -> &BTreeSet<String> {
74        &self.declared
75    }
76
77    /// Reads the declarations out of retained catalog entries.
78    ///
79    /// This is the site that OBSERVES an entry it cannot decode, so this is the
80    /// site that says so: an undecodable entry is recorded by its stored
81    /// identity and reported at WARN, naming what must be re-deployed. It is
82    /// never skipped in silence — a skipped entry turns into a confident,
83    /// terminal refusal three seams downstream.
84    pub(crate) fn read<'entries>(
85        entries: impl IntoIterator<Item = &'entries LoadedWorkflow>,
86    ) -> Self {
87        let mut declared = BTreeSet::new();
88        let mut undecodable_identities = Vec::new();
89        for workflow in entries {
90            match workflow.contract() {
91                Ok(contract) => {
92                    for worker in &contract.workers {
93                        declared.insert(worker.task_queue.clone());
94                    }
95                }
96                Err(ContractIdentityError::RedeployRequired { stored_version }) => {
97                    undecodable_identities.push(stored_version);
98                }
99            }
100        }
101        if !undecodable_identities.is_empty() {
102            tracing::warn!(
103                undecodable_identities = %undecodable_identities.join(", "),
104                declared_queues = declared.len(),
105                "catalog entries carry no decodable contract; their task queues are unknowable \
106                 and no queue can be reported undeclared until they are re-deployed under `.v4`"
107            );
108        }
109        Self {
110            declared,
111            undecodable_identities,
112        }
113    }
114}
